For any selected track that is part of a playlist,
additional info about the list is now provided in
the [Playlist] field of the Track Info screen.
1) Asterisk indicates if playlist has been modified.
2) Playlist filename is visible, unless the current
playlist is *not* associated with a file on disk, in
which case the following will be shown instead:
- (Folder) for unmodified folder playlists.
- (Dynamic) for playlists that are neither associated
with a playlist file, nor with a folder.

1) Adds way to pop activity without refreshing the skin at
the same time.
Activities are sometimes popped in immediate succession,
or one activity is popped before another one is pushed right
away. This can lead to the UI appearing glitchy, due to an
activity only appearing for a split-second, which is especially
noticeable with complex skins that change the dimensions
of the UI viewport depending on the current activity
To fix this, prevent superfluous skin updates
* when switching between:
- WPS and browser
- WPS and Playlist Catalogue
- WPS and playlist
- WPS and Settings/System/Plugins
* when accessing Track Info or when displaying
bookmarks using the context menu on the WPS
* when switching from QuickScreen to Shortcuts Menu
2) The playlist viewer activity was pushed & popped
redundantly by playlist_view.
----
NB:
Behavior has remained unchanged in all instances of the
code where pop_current_activity() has been replaced by
pop_current_activity(ACTIVITY_REFRESH_NOW).

Removing the "list_wrap" argument is actually pretty easy.
In practice, almost all lists are using LIST_WRAP_UNLESS_HELD
behavior so we can make that the default. A couple of lists
disable wraparound with LIST_WRAP_OFF; this is now achieved
by setting the list "wraparound" flag to false when setting
up the list. LIST_WRAP_ON was unused and is of questionable
value, so it has been removed entirely.
This makes list wraparound behavior a property of the list,
controlled solely by the "wraparound" flag. The result is a
simpler list API and implementation, without changing the
behavior of any lists.

The format strings in the snprintf can in theory need 60 characters
This will not happen in practice (because seconds are 0..60 and not
full-range integers etc.), but -D_FORTIFY_SOURCE will still warn
about it, so we use 60 characters for HOSTED to make the compiler
happy. Native builds still use 20, which is enough in practice.

ATA power is off in the charging screen to avoid problems when the battery
is deeply discharged. Without ATA power, Archos FM and V2 Recorders measure
battery voltage as 0V, leading to an unwanted low battery shutdown. This
change delays powermgmt_init() on those targets until after ATA power is
turned on by storage_init(). The charging screen displays input current,
so there is some visible feedback on charging progress.
